Wellsboro ran their win streak to 10 games following a 17-2, 3-inning, victory over Wyalusing Friday afternoon.
The win moves the Hornets to the #2 seed in District IV's Class 3A playoff race with three games remaining.
The Hornets started the game with 4 runs in the 1st inning, then exploded for 13 runs in the bottom of the 2nd, after Wyalusing cut the game in half with 2 runs in the top half of the inning.
Senior Marek Mascho had a big day at the plate, driving in 4 runs on 3 hits (3-for-3) with a double while scoring 3 runs. Wellsboro had 8 hits on the day. Junior Coen Tennis (1-for-1), senior Cameron Owlett (1-for-2), sophomore Kody Enck (1-for-3), freshman Gage Baltzley (1-for-3) and sophomore Reed Richardson (1-for-3) backed up Mascho.
Tennis and Baltzley drove in 3 runs apiece, Enck had 2 RBIs, and Owlett, Richardson and sophomore Gabe Cuneo all drove in solo runs. Marek Mascho, junior Max Mascho and Cuneo all scored three times, Tennis, Owlett and sophomore Griffin Morral scored two runs each, and Baltzley and Richardson scored once.
Junior Syler Pietrzyk earned the win from the mound, allowing 2 runs on 2 hits with a walk and a strikeout. Max Mascho threw the final inning, allowing 1 hit and striking out 3.
Wellsboro (14-2, 12-1 NTL Large School Division) travels to Williamson for a 2:00 p.m. Sunday afternoon game.
